On Mon, Jul 15, 2002 at 04:27:05PM +0300, Stephan Trajkoff wrote:

> My K class server works perfect with 240 users for mail.
> this server has apache, squid, pine,qmail

Quite nice.

> 4 cpu with 120mhz, 512mb ramm, 18GB HDD, what more???

* squid doesn't actually use more than one processor (state machine!)
* qmail is I/O bound.

Only a new Apache2 would benefit from a multi processor box.
If you replace qmail with postfix, you might speed things up a bit.
